Trace heavy metal monitoring is crucial in wastewater treatment primarily to prevent contamination and ensure compliance with environmental regulations. Heavy metals, even in small concentrations, can be toxic to aquatic life and can accumulate in the food chain, posing risks to human health and the environment. By continuously monitoring these contaminants, treatment facilities can effectively identify and mitigate any potential risks associated with heavy metal discharges.

Additionally, regulatory frameworks set specific limits for heavy metals in treated effluents. Compliance with these regulations is essential for operating a wastewater treatment facility and avoiding potential fines, legal issues, and detrimental impacts on public health and ecosystems. Continuous monitoring allows for timely interventions should heavy metal levels approach or exceed regulatory limits, ensuring that treatment processes are effective and that discharges remain within safe thresholds.

Maintaining such compliance not only protects the environment but also promotes public trust in wastewater management practices. Monitoring heavy metals is thus a fundamental aspect of effective wastewater treatment, ensuring both safety and adherence to legal standards.
